Output 31fd342796a39a47dfda6dfe07ba2cfb503df42af90ec6385d6e3d64992fdd4a:1

value
22594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687abfbcb10b1c7a78cc02ad55111c0b3b0d3017 OP_EQUAL
address
3BDTFF1GssnmDMMgSmvUn4UtVa4QKVz1fc
transaction
31fd342796a39a47dfda6dfe07ba2cfb503df42af90ec6385d6e3d64992fdd4a
spent
true